What this opportunity is

This is a finance internship designed to give practical workplace exposure to someone who wants to build experience in finance and accounting. The role supports the finance department with analysis, budgeting, forecasting, reconciliations, reporting support, and day-to-day finance administration.

Note: This is more suitable for someone who wants practical accounting and finance exposure than for someone looking for a general admin internship. The advert points directly to financial analysis, reporting, reconciliations, and finance support tasks.

What you’ll do / learn

You’ll gain practical finance experience across analysis, reporting, reconciliations, forecasting, research, and day-to-day finance support work.

  • Assist with financial analysis, budgeting, and forecasting
  • Support the preparation of financial reports and presentations
  • Assist in the reconciliation of accounts and financial statements
  • Help with data entry and organisation of financial records
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ams on finance-related projects
  • Perform ad-hoc financial tasks and analysis as needed

What this role really means

A finance internship like this usually means learning how everyday finance work supports the wider business. In practice, that can include preparing and checking reports, supporting reconciliations, keeping financial records organised, and helping with budgeting or forecasting tasks. If you are applying, it helps to show that you are analytical, accurate, and comfortable working with numbers and spreadsheets.
